However, steam cleaners usually come with a selection of attachments, including brushes for intensive cleaning of smaller areas and scrapers or wipers for, say, cleaning worktops or glass. The main head is usually a mop head, with some kind of pad or microfibre cloth attached so that the steam separates the grime from the surface and the pad or cloth wipes it away. First, you have the classic steam cleaner, comprising the steamer unit – where the water is housed and boiled – which connects through a pipe to the head where the steam is dispensed. Steam cleaners come in three basic formats.

Steam cleaners will make light work of your kitchen and bathroom, and they can sort out worked-in dirt and stains that you’ll struggle to shift by other means. It may be true that there’s nothing you can’t clean with the right tools and a bit of elbow grease, but that doesn’t mean you shouldn’t make it easier for yourself. The best steam cleaners are great for wiping the grime from almost any hard surface, or even cleaning some soft furnishings.
